WYE-687
WYE-687 is a potent and selective ATP-competitive mTOR inhibitor with an IC50 of 7 nM. It effectively suppresses mTORC1 and mTORC2 signaling by inhibiting pS6K (T389) and pAKT (S473), respectively, while showing high selectivity over PI3K isoforms. This inhibitor is a valuable tool for studying mTOR-dependent pathways in cancer and metabolic disease research, both in vitro and in vivo.
